Shelf life Extension of Sugarcane Juice
Author Name : Hritika Madekar, Yash Haval, Asavari Narvekar, Anushka Chavan
INTRODUCTION
Sugarcane juice is a instant energy booster juice extracted by a natural source called sugarcane. Sugarcane juice is usually extracted by simply just pressing the sugarcane in between the rollers and a popular drink served in the hot summers. Packed with a efficient source of sugar it is also a great source of essential nutrients. The juice is available only in the parts of sugarcane cultivation. The reason is the juice gets degrade easily by enzymatic actions. Unprocessed juice offers idealized conditions for the development of microorganisms. The fresh sugarcane juice has a shorter shelf because of browning and fermentation in presence of enzymes, yeast and bacteria.
The project work mainly focuses on the enhancement of shelf life of sugarcane juice by membrane filtration. Membrane technology assures low color degradation Use of ultrafiltration to remove the spoilage causing micro-organisms .the membranes have a very small pore size which works efficiently. Ultrafiltration a subclass of membrane filtration in which forces like pressure or concentration gradients lead to a separation through a semipermeable membrane.it is a specialized membrane filtration technology. It uses hydrostatic pressure forces a liquid against a semipermeable membrane. The types of membrane usually studied are tubular membrane, hollow fibre membrane and flatsheet membrane.
